Red and Blue Living Room Decorating Ideas
Red and blue are complementary colors, meaning they sit opposite each other on the color wheel. This creates a striking contrast that can be both energizing and calming. When used in a living room, red and blue can create a space that is both stylish and inviting.
There are many ways to incorporate red and blue into your living room decor. One popular option is to use a red and blue color scheme. This can be done by painting the walls one color and the trim the other, or by using red and blue furniture and accessories. Another option is to use red and blue as accent colors. This can be done by adding red and blue pillows to a neutral-colored sofa, or by hanging red and blue artwork on the walls.
No matter how you choose to use them, red and blue are a great way to add style and personality to your living room. Here are a few ideas to get you started:
- Paint the walls red and the trim blue. This will create a bold and dramatic look that is sure to make a statement.
- Add a red and blue rug to a neutral-colored living room. This will add a touch of color and pattern without overwhelming the space.
- Hang red and blue artwork on the walls. This is a great way to add a personal touch to your living room and to reflect your own style.
- Use red and blue pillows to add a pop of color to a neutral-colored sofa. This is a simple and inexpensive way to update the look of your living room.
- Add a red and blue throw blanket to the back of a sofa or chair. This will add a touch of warmth and comfort to the space.
- Use red and blue accessories to complete the look of your living room. This could include anything from vases to lamps to candles.

Tips for Decorating with Red and Blue
Here are a few tips to help you decorate your living room with red and blue:
- Use the 60-30-10 rule. This means that 60% of the room should be one color, 30% should be another color, and 10% should be an accent color.
- Choose the right shade of red and blue. There are many different shades of red and blue, so it is important to choose ones that work well together. If you are not sure what shades to choose, you can always consult with a professional interior designer.
- Balance the colors. Red and blue are both strong colors, so it is important to balance them out in the room. You can do this by using more of one color than the other, or by using different shades of the same color.
- Add some neutral colors. Neutral colors can help to tone down the intensity of red and blue. You can add neutral colors through the use of furniture, rugs, and accessories.
